How they compare

Guinea currently reports 0.09 t against 0.07 t in Saint Lucia, a difference of 0.02 t.

That makes Guinea's figure about 1.3 times Saint Lucia's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 10 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Saint Lucia ahead.

Guinea ranks 136th and Saint Lucia ranks 139th of 170 countries.

Saint Lucia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
